**Motorcycle Storage Available Soon at Franklin Motors - Dublin 13** Need a place to store your motorcycle for the winter or on a week-to-week basis? Our new facility, NOW OPEN in Dublin 13, offers secure storage for all types of motorcycles. **What we offer:** - Trickle charging for your bike - 24-hour monitored security - All motorcycles covered with proper protective covers **Additional services (optional charge):** - Full valet - Tire replacement and fitting Spaces are limited, so don’t wait! Our facility will open in the next few weeks. Call us at **015385005** to book your slot today. Note min * 1 month* @ €123 per month. Franklin Motors
